Reasons for the Price of Bio Farma PCR Equipment Dropped from Rp325 Thousand to Rp90 Thousand

Jakarta, CNN Indonesia

PT Bio Farma (Persero) discloses the price of tools PCR test owned by the company will decrease from around Rp. 325 thousand in August 2020 to Rp. 90 thousand per kit before tax in October 2021. This price decline can occur if there is an increase in production capacity.

“This price is imposed with the hope that demand will increase and Bio Farma can optimize its production capacity of up to 5 million tests per month,” said Bio Farma President Director Honesti Basyir during a hearing with Commission VI DPR at the DPR/MPR Building, Tuesday (9/9). /11).

Currently, the production of PCR kits at Bio Farma ranges from 1.2 million to 2 million kits per month. However, the company is trying to increase production to 5 million kits per month.

Apart from being supported by increased production, he claimed that price reductions were also possible because there were innovations in PCR test kits starting from the mBioCov to the newest BioSaliva.

“So the market began to demand and the needs began to increase,” he added.

Even so, according to his explanation, currently the PCR kit price is actually still valid at Rp. 193,000 per kit, including taxes. This current price, also known as the e-catalog price, has been in effect since February 2021.

“The price of the e-catalog that is still running is still IDR 193,000 including VAT, which has been broadcast since February 2021, and is currently in the process of submitting a new price of IDR 89,100 including tax,” he explained.

Furthermore, the price of the PCR kit is one of the components that make up the price structure of the PCR test from Bio Farma as a whole. This price is included in the components of production costs and raw materials, which account for 55 percent of the total PCR price structure.

The rest is operational costs of around 16 percent of the total price of PCR tests, 14 percent distribution costs, 5 percent royalties, and 10 percent profit for the company.
